Update

Ok I had the evil gallbladder removed yesterday. Immediately after I woke up I felt relief!! The first time in months I dont feel that lump under my rib, no more random stabbing pain, and best of all no more nausea!!!

I woke up feeling no pain, just a sore throat. I was happy to see that my wonderful surgeon could use 2 of my old incisions(from banding) and the 3rd is in my belly button so it wont show. Not that i have any intention of showing my belly but less scars makes me feel better.

I am feeling great and hope to get back in the gym on Monday- obviously taking it very lightly but need to do something.

Back to tracking my food intake and really sticking to low fat, non greasy things. Need to go food shopping today- get some lean ground turkey instead of beef, hubby and kids are going to riot!!!
